Grey Industries has a defined benefit pension plan that specifies annual retirement benefits equal to 1.7% * Service years * Final year's salary Derek Shepherd was hired by Grey at the beginning of 2001. Shepherd is expected to retire after 45 years of service. His retirement is expected to span 15 years. At the end of 2020, 20 years after being hired, his salary is $70,000. The company's actuary projects Shepherd's salary to be $90,000 at retirement. The actuary's discount rate is 6%. Here are the various present value factors (USE ONLY THESE FACTORS) PVA Factors PV Factors PVA, n=15, i=6% 9.71225 PV, n=15, 1-6% 41727 PVA, n=20,56% 11.46992 PV, n=20,16% 31180 PVA, n=25, 1-6% PV, n 25. I +6% 12.78336 .23300 a. Estimate the amount of Derek Shepherd's annual retirement payment for his retirement years earned as of the end of 2020. b. Suppose Grey's pension plan permits a lump-sum payment at retirement in lieu of annuity payments. Determine the lump-sum equivalent as the present value as of the retirement date of annuity payments during the retirement period. c. What is the company's projected benefit obligation at the end of 2020 with respect to Derek Shepherd? d. Even though pension accounting centers on the PBO calculation, the ABO still must be disclosed in the pension disclosure note. What is the company's accumulated benefit obligation at the end of 2020 with respect to Derek Shepherd
